1. Introduction

This user guide is designed to assist students and readers in effectively engaging with Computer Organization and Architecture by William Stallings, 11th Edition. This textbook provides a comprehensive overview of the fundamental principles of computer organization and architecture, covering topics from basic digital logic to advanced processor design and parallel processing. This specific edition is designated as a rental copy.
